Comparing Fabric Density and Material Quality!

A fabric’s density fabric can be determined in grams of the square meter. The greater the density of fibers, as well as the more robust it is.
The quality of the material is assessed by how much the fabric is able to withstand before it loses its form and becomes threadbare. The better the quality is the longer you will be able to wear a piece of clothing before it gets worn out.

There are two types of cotton, Regular and Extra-long staples. A cotton fabric is comprised of plants’ seeds. The length of the fibers is a measure of how soft or tough the fabric will be dependent on whether the fabric is made of shorter or longer fibers. A fabric woven from long staple cotton will have an elongated feel than one made from smaller staple cotton.
